Dudila
Dudila is a village located in Garud tehsil of Bageshwar district in Uttarakhand,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Garud (tehsildar office) and 26km away from district headquarter Bageshwar. As per 2009 stats, Dudhila is the gram panchayat of Dudila village.

About Dudila
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dudila is 051391. The village spans a total geographical area of 58.17 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 263641. Bageshwar is nearest town to Dudila village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 26km away.

Population of Dudila
Below is a concise population overview of Dudila as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 470 | 239 | 231 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 67 | 40 | 27 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 469 | 238 | 231 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 325 | 178 | 147 |
Illiterate Population | 145 | 61 | 84 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Dudila village:
- The total population of Dudila village is around 470, including approximately 239 males and 231 females, with a sex ratio of 966 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 67 children aged 0–6 years in Dudila village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Dudila village has 469 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Dudila village is about 69.15%, with male literacy at 74.48% and female literacy at 63.64%.
- There are around 91 households in Dudila village.
Connectivity of Dudila
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dudila. As per the 2011 stats, Dudila had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
